When you know about this project and you want to new install PySPX to support your project or you get trouble as ModuleNotFoundError: No module named "PySPX" or ImportError: cannot import name "PySPX" in your project, let follow this tutorial to install PySPX
In Windows (CMD):
py -m pip --version
In Unix/macOS:
python3 -m pip --version
Ensure pip, setuptools, and wheel are up to date:
In Windows (CMD):
py -m pip install --upgrade pip setuptools wheel
In Unix/macOS:
python3 -m pip install --upgrade pip setuptools wheel

To install PySPX on Windows(CMD):
py -m pip install PySPX
To install PySPX on Unix/macOs:
pip install PySPX
Example:
pip install PySPX==0.1.0
